## Releases — ChronoStride Chip Reader. Support staff can cut a firmware release by tagging the main branch; the Pacemark build server compiles, signs, and publishes the image to the reader fleet automatically. Never distribute unsigned images to race-day hardware, as readers will refuse them at the start line. The build server signs each image with the key below.

rollout seal: bky4_yke3

## 3.2.0 — Changed defaults

Heads up, future maintainers: Textgrove now defaults to strict encoding detection on uploaded text files. We used to silently assume UTF-8 and mangle the occasional Latin-1 invoice; now ambiguous files get sniffed and flagged instead. Detection runs before virus scan. The detector ships with these defaults.

config for tajof-kawep:
[aldius]
port = 3000
region = lower-2
host = aldius.plorvasoft.example
team = eliius
timeout_ms = 750
retries = 6

Runbook 7.2 — Promoting Firmware to the Stable Channel

Before promoting a Larkspur device build from beta to stable, confirm that the soak test has run for at least 72 hours and that rollback images are staged on the update server. New team members: never skip the checksum verification step, even under deadline pressure — a bad image bricks devices in the field. Once verification passes, sign the firmware bundle for the stable channel using the key shown below.

deploy key for kajof-fajop: bky6_gDHw9Q

[ ] Tax-rate lookup cache — confirm the Bramblewick pricing service invalidates cached rates within one hour of a jurisdiction table update, and that cache entries are keyed by region code only, with no customer data stored. Review the eviction logs from staging for anomalies before sign-off. Attach your approval to the release record using the token below.

pipeline stamp: htk14_5717f383a4ad4f